diff --git a/src/ui/window.cpp b/src/ui/window.cpp index f92811a7..b976ca6a 100644 --- a/src/ui/window.cpp +++ b/src/ui/window.cpp @@ -7,6 +7,92 @@ #include "render/window_render_object.hpp" namespace cru::ui { +namespace { +// Dispatch the event. +// +// This will raise routed event of the control and its parent and parent's +// parent ... (until "last_receiver" if it's not nullptr) with appropriate args. +// +// First tunnel from top to bottom possibly stopped by "handled" flag in +// EventArgs. Second bubble from bottom to top possibly stopped by "handled" +// flag in EventArgs. Last direct to each control. +// +// Args is of type "EventArgs". The first init argument is "sender", which is +// automatically bound to each receiving control. The second init argument is +// "original_sender", which is unchanged. And "args" will be perfectly forwarded +// as the rest arguments. +template <typename EventArgs, typename... Args> +void DispatchEvent(Control* const original_sender, + events::RoutedEvent<EventArgs> Control::*event_ptr, + Control* const last_receiver, Args&&... args) { + std::list<Control*> receive_list; + + auto parent = original_sender; + while (parent != last_receiver) { + receive_list.push_back(parent); + parent = parent->GetParent(); + } + + auto handled = false; + + // tunnel + for (auto i = receive_list.crbegin(); i != receive_list.crend(); ++i) { + EventArgs event_args(*i, original_sender, std::forward<Args>(args)...); + (*i->*event_ptr).tunnel.Raise(event_args); + if (event_args.IsHandled()) { + handled = true; + break; + } + } + + // bubble + if (!handled) { + for (auto i : receive_list) { + EventArgs event_args(i, original_sender, std::forward<Args>(args)...); + (i->*event_ptr).bubble.Raise(event_args); + if (event_args.IsHandled()) break; + } + } + + // direct + for (auto i : receive_list) { + EventArgs event_args(i, original_sender, std::forward<Args>(args)...); + (i->*event_ptr).direct.Raise(event_args); + } +} + +std::list<Control*> GetAncestorList(Control* control) { + std::list<Control*> l; + while (control != nullptr) { + l.push_front(control); + control = control->GetParent(); + } + return l; +} + +Control* FindLowestCommonAncestor(Control* left, Control* right) { + if (left == nullptr || right == nullptr) return nullptr; + + auto&& left_list = GetAncestorList(left); + auto&& right_list = GetAncestorList(right); + + // the root is different + if (left_list.front() != right_list.front()) return nullptr; + + // find the last same control or the last control (one is ancestor of the + // other) + auto left_i = left_list.cbegin(); + auto right_i = right_list.cbegin(); + while (true) { + if (left_i == left_list.cend()) return *(--left_i); + if (right_i == right_list.cend()) return *(--right_i); + if (*left_i != *right_i) return *(--left_i); + ++left_i; + ++right_i; + } +} +} // namespace + LRESULT __stdcall GeneralWndProc(HWND hWnd, UINT Msg, WPARAM wParam, LPARAM lParam) { auto window = WindowManager::GetInstance()->FromHandle(hWnd); |
